Windows 7 is a pirate version installed by the pc man building the rig a few years ago. 

^^This is the old rig with the SSD in it btw.

 

Im going to reuse my SSD from the old rig, and put it into the new rig, but when i try to formatting the SSD i just cant :( A error pops up saying something like '' U cant formatting this because it is in use)

Ah, you need to boot from a USB to format it because you're trying to format it from windows and it cant delete itself when its being used. So yeah, get a windows 8.1 usb and boot from that then you can install it. Alternatley get a Linux distro and use gparted to format the SSD

Well i allready have the CD with Windows 8.1...

Shove ssd in new pc,

Boot in new pc from windows 8.1 cd

While installing win8 you will be able to format the drives and make partitons.. Do that

Done
